The FV-1000GM: a 1000W Modular Power Supply with ATX 3.1 Standard

To build a high-performance system, choosing the right power supply is fundamental. The FV-1000GM model is presented as a fully modular option that delivers 1000 nominal watts, following the ATX standard. Its 80 PLUS Gold certification ensures that it converts mains power with high efficiency, helping the entire system generate less residual heat. 🚀

Native Connector for the Most Demanding Graphics Cards

One of its standout features is the inclusion of a native 12V-2x6 cable, also referred to as PCIe 5.1. This connector can supply up to 600 watts directly, eliminating the need for adapters that can overheat. It is designed to power high-end graphics cards like the NVIDIA RTX 4080, 4090 series and future 5080/5090.

Key advantages of the native connector:
  • Supplies stable power of up to 600W directly to the GPU.
  • Eliminates adapters, reducing potential failure points and overheating.
  • Prepares the system for future high-power graphics components.

Ready for the Most Intense Power Spikes

This model fully complies with the ATX 3.1 specification. This standard is crucial because it defines how the power supply must respond to the instantaneous power demands of components like the CPU and GPU. The FV-1000GM can handle power excursions of up to 200% of its nominal load during extremely short intervals.

Capabilities according to ATX 3.1:
  • Supports peaks of up to 2000 watts for 100 microseconds.
  • Maintains system stability during maximum instantaneous loads.
  • Essential for demanding tasks like rendering or 4K gaming with ray tracing.
